About Molaiya Village

Molaiya is a small village in Mauganj tehsil, in the district of Rewa, Madhya Pradesh. The Census of India 2011 recorded a population of 236, made up of 130 males and 106 females. That works out to a sex ratio of about 815 females per 1000 males. The village covers 32.82 hectares hectares.
